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roof and installing a new roofing system to ensure the property remains protected from the elements. The process typically includes inspecting the current roof, preparing the surface, and applying a new layer of roofing material suitable for flat surfaces. This service aims to address issues such as persistent leaks, extensive damage, or aging materials that no longer provide adequate protection. Professionals evaluate the structure to determine the most appropriate replacement method, ensuring the new roof is durable and properly installed.
One of the primary benefits of flat roof replacement is resolving ongoing problems related to water infiltration. Flat roofs are more susceptible to pooling water and drainage issues, which can lead to leaks and water damage inside the building. Replacing an aging or damaged flat roof can help prevent structural deterioration, mold growth, and interior damage caused by moisture intrusion. Additionally, a new roof can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and sealing, contributing to lower utility costs over time.
Flat roof replacement services are commonly utilized on commercial properties, such as warehouses, office buildings, and retail centers, where flat roofing systems are prevalent due to their cost-effectiveness and ease of maintenance. However, resid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s, such as certain apartment complexes or modern-style homes, also benefit from this service. Material and Size Factors - The cost of flat roof repl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the roof's size and material choice. Larger roofs or premium materials can push costs higher, sometimes exceeding $20,000. Local pros can provide precise estimates based on specific project details.
Labor and Installation Expenses - Labor costs for flat roof replacement usually account for a significant portion of the total, often between $2,000 and $6,000. Complex roof designs or difficult access may increase labor charges, influencing overall project costs.
Material Options and Quality - Common materials like EPDM or TPO typically cost between $4 and $8 per square foot, whereas more durable or specialized options can be more expensive. The choice of material impacts both initial costs and long-term maintenance expenses.
Additional Costs and Factors - Extra expenses such as roof removal, disposal, or reinforcement can add $1,000 to $3,000 or more. Costs vary based on existing roof condition and project scope, emphasizing the importance of consulting local service providers for accurate quotes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a flat roof be replaced? The lifespan of a flat roof varies based on materials and maintenance, but generally, it may need replacement every 15-20 years. Consulting with local roofing professionals can help determine the right timing for your roof.
What are common signs that a flat ro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ive membrane damage, ponding water, or noticeable deterioration of roofing materials. A professional inspection can identify if replacement is necessary.
What types of materials are used for flat roof replacements? Common materials include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, EPDM rubber, and TPO membranes. Local contractors can recommend suitable options based on your building’s needs.
How long does a flat ro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days by experienced service providers.
